CMT4501W

Bluetooth Low Energy (BLE) System on Chip

CMT4501.png

Introduction:


CMT4501 is a System on Chip (SoC) for Bluetooth® low energy applications. CMT4501 has 32-bit ARM® Cortex™-M0 CPU with 138KSRAM/Retention SRAM and an ultra-low power, high performance, multi-mode radio. CMT4501 can support BLE with security, application and over-the-air download update. Serial peripheral IO and integrated application IP enables customer product to be built with minimum bill-of-material (BOM) cost.


Key Features:


  • ARM® Cortex™-M0 32-bit processor

  • Memory:

  • 512/256KB in-system flash memory

  • 128KB ROM

  • 138KB SRAM, all programmable retention in sleep mode

  • 8-channel DMA

  • 33/19 general purpose I/O pins:

  • All pins can be configured as serial interface and programmable IO MUX function mapping

  • All pins can be configured for wake-up

  • 18 pins for triggering interrupt

  • 3 quadrature decoder(QDEC)

  • 6-channel PWM

  • 4-channel I2S

  • 2-channel PDM

  • 2-channel I2C

  • 2-channel SPI

  • 1-channel UART

  • JTAG

  • 8-channel 12bit ADC with analog PGA

  • 4-channel32bit timer, one watchdog timer

  • Real timer counter (RTC)

  • Power, clock, reset controller

  • Flexible power management:

  • Supply voltage range 1.8V to 3.6V

  • Embedded buck DC-DC

  • Embedded LDOs

  • Battery monitor: Supports low battery detection

  • 2μA @ Sleep Mode with 32KHz RTC

  • 0.7μA @ OFF Mode(IO wake up only)

  • 2.4 GHz transceiver:

  • Compliant to Bluetooth 4.0, ETSI EN 300 328 and EN 300 440 Class 2

    (Europe), FCC CFR47 Part 15 (US) and ARIB STD-T66 (Japan)

  • Sensitivity:

-97dBm@BLE 1Mbps data rate

-103dBm@BLE 125Kbps data rate

  • TX Power -20 to +10dBm in 3dB steps

  • Receiver: 8mA @sensitivity level

  • Transmitter: 8mA @0dBm TX power

  • Single-pin antenna: no RF matching or RX/TX switching required

  • RSSI (1dB resolution)

  • RC oscillator hardware calibrations: 

  • 32KHz RC oscillator automatic calibration

  • 32MHz RC oscillator automatic calibration

  • AES-128 encryption hardware:

  • AES-ECB

  • AES-CCM

  •  Link layer hardware:

  • Automatic packet assembly

  • Automatic packet detection and validation

  • Auto Re-transmit

  • Auto ACK

  • Hardware Address Matching

  • Random number generator

  • Operating temperature: -40 ℃~125℃

  • RoHS Package: QFN32


Applications: 


wearables, beacons, appliances, home and building, health and medical, sports and fitness, industrial and manufacturing, retail and payment, security, data transmission, remote control, PC/mobile/TV peripherals, internet of things (IoT)
